Which banks in the UK offer custody?

Custody means the provider holds coins for you rather than just moving fiat around them. ClearBank is out because it offers no crypto custody at all; clients keep control of their own wallets. The full passes split by customer: Xapo Bank holds Bitcoin 1:1 through its GFSC-regulated VASP with MPC key sharding, Revolut holds crypto for individuals in the UK under its FCA cryptoasset registration, and Standard Chartered custodies Bitcoin and Ether for institutions through Zodia Custody and a DFSA licence, with nothing for retail. The partials each come with a limit: LHV holds the 15 assets you buy in-app but will not let them leave the bank, Wirex holds balances as an e-money institution with no deposit protection on either fiat or crypto, and BCB Group's crypto services are for business clients, with trading closed to most UK residents.

Questions people ask

Who actually holds my Bitcoin if I bank with Xapo from the UK?

Xapo VASP Limited, a GFSC-regulated DLT provider in Gibraltar, holds it 1:1 with MPC key sharding. Deposits and withdrawals work on-chain and over Lightning, with Lightning capped at USD 1,000 per invoice and USD 5,000 per 24 hours. Send only Bitcoin: any other digital currency sent to a Xapo Bitcoin address is lost.

Which UK bank custodies crypto but will not let me withdraw it to my own wallet?

LHV. You can buy, sell and hold 15 crypto assets inside the LHV app, but transferring them to an external wallet or exchange is blocked, and you cannot send crypto in either. To move value out you sell inside the bank and withdraw euros. Revolut and Xapo Bank both allow withdrawals to external wallets, with Revolut blocking addresses it links to unsupported exchanges.
